Ernesto Treccani
Ernesto Treccani (1920–2009) was an Italian painter, sculptor and writer.

Overview
Born at Milan in 1920, died at Milan in 2009.
In detail
Ernesto Treccani studied at Polytechnic University of Milan. the recorded working language is Italian.
The field of work recorded is painting, art of sculpture and creative and professional writing.
Works named in the authority record are Composizione agreste.
Work by Ernesto Treccani is recorded in the collections of Arcumeggia open-air mural gallery.
